Characterisation of coherent rotating modes in a magnetised plasma column using a mono-sensor tomography diagnostic

Abstract

In this paper we report on an original tomographic diagnostic using a single sensor on a magnetized plasma column. The experimental setup and the numerical inversion method used to interpret the data are presented. The core plasma evolution during the rotation of coherent modes is characterized with this tomography diagnostic. The experimental observations show that the mode shape is constant during the plasma rotation. The results are also compared to two-dimensional probe measurements.
